Partager via


Guide de résolution des problèmes de l’extension Projets SSIS pour Visual Studio 2022+

S’applique à : SQL ServerBase de données Azure SQLAzure Synapse Analytics

Important

Vous pouvez télécharger l’extension SQL Server Integration Services (SSIS) à partir de Visual Studio Marketplace.

Visitez le blog SQL Server Integration Services (SSIS) pour obtenir les dernières informations, conseils, actualités et annonces sur SSIS directement à partir de l’équipe produit. Les notes de publication d’extension des services d'intégration (SSIS) sont répertoriées sur le marketplace extension.

Téléchargement du composant

Problèmes courants

  • La tâche d’exécution de package SSIS ne prend pas en charge le débogage lorsque le paramètre ExecuteOutOfProcess est défini sur True.

  • Les composants tiers ne sont pas encore pris en charge.

  • Parfois, ce produit ou Visual Studio Tools pour Applications 2022 peut être supprimé en quelque sorte pendant la mise à niveau de l’instance Visual Studio. Si vos projets SSIS existants ne peuvent pas être chargés, essayez de réparer ce produit via le Panneau de configuration. Si Visual Studio ne s’affiche pas lors de la sélection de Modifier le script, essayez de réparer VSTA 2022 via le panneau de configuration.

  • Problème SSDT côte à côte. Les extensions SQL Server Analysis Services et SQL Server Reporting Services peuvent désormais fonctionner côte à côte avec cette extension dans Visual Studio 2022 17.4 et les versions précédentes. La solution de contournement consiste à télécharger Visual Studio 2022 17.5 Preview 2 ou ultérieur.

  • SQL Server Native Client (SNAC) n’est pas fourni avec :

    • 2022 - SQL Server 16 (16.x) et versions ultérieures
    • SQL Server Management Studio 19 et versions ultérieures

    SQL Server Native Client (SQLNCLI ou SQLNCLI11) et le fournisseur Microsoft OLE DB pour SQL Server (SQLOLEDB) hérité ne sont pas recommandés pour le développement de nouvelles applications.

    Pour les nouveaux projets, utilisez l'un des pilotes suivants :

    Pour SQLNCLI qui est fourni en tant que composant du moteur de base de données SQL Server (versions 2012 à 2019), consultez cette exception du cycle de vie du support.

  • Si Oracle, Teradata ou un autre composant OOB n’est pas trouvé après la mise à niveau de SSDT, vérifiez que le connecteur pour la dernière version de SQL Server est installé.

Problèmes connus

  1. Dans le menu contextuel (bouton droit de la souris) sur les objets du projet (par exemple, la solution, un package) dans Visual Studio, de nombreuses entrées apparaissent plusieurs fois.
  2. Parfois, lorsque vous réparez ou mettez à jour Visual Studio, l’extension SSIS peut être désinstallée. Réinstallez-le à nouveau.
  3. Si SSIS est installé correctement, mais que l’Explorateur de solutions affiche incompatible, ou The application is not installed:
    1. Ouvrez Visual Studio et accédez à l’extension>Gérer les extensions>installées
    2. Activer l’extension SSIS
    3. Relancer Visual Studio

Pour plus d’informations, consultez les notes de publication.

Problèmes d’installation

Le fichier journal d’installation, Microsoft.DataTools.IntegrationServices_{Timestamp}_ISVsix.log, se trouve sous le dossier %temp%\SsdtisSetup. Vérifiez les messages d’erreur dans le fichier journal et suivez les étapes de résolution des problèmes suivantes :

  1. Vérification préalable échouée : AnotherInstallationRunning

    • Si le fichier journal contient des mots clés : Pre-check verification failed with warning(s): AnotherInstallationRunning, continuez à attendre et réessayer.
    • Cette erreur se produit, car Windows Installer bloque votre installation. Windows Installer est un sous-service de Windows qui gère l’installation de packages tels que des MSIs, Windows Update ou un composant tiers, et il ne peut gérer qu’une seule chose à la fois.
  2. Autres erreurs

Installation hors connexion

Suivez les étapes ci-dessous pour installer ce produit dans un environnement hors connexion :

  1. Reportez-vous aux instructions de la page Créer un package d’installation hors connexion de Visual Studio pour l’installation locale, puis vérifiez que les conditions préalables suivantes sont remplies :

    • Prerequisite ID="Microsoft.VisualStudio.Component.Roslyn.LanguageServices" Version="[17.0,)" DisplayName="C# and Visual Basic"
    • Prerequisite ID="Microsoft.VisualStudio.Component.CoreEditor" Version="[17.0,)" DisplayName="Visual Studio core editor"
    • Prerequisite ID="Microsoft.Net.Component.4.7.TargetingPack" Version="[17.0,)" DisplayName=".NET Framework 4.7 targeting pack"
  2. Lancez le programme d’installation de ce produit et effectuez l’installation, ou vous pouvez exécuter le programme d’installation en mode silencieux. Lancez le programme d’installation avec l’argument /? pour obtenir plus de détails sur la liste des arguments du programme d’installation.

  3. Visual Studio Community ne prend pas en charge l’activation hors connexion. Pour utiliser ce produit avec Visual Studio Community, vous devez vous connecter à votre compte Microsoft occasionnellement dans Visual Studio Community. Si vous souhaitez utiliser ce produit dans un environnement hors connexion, nous vous recommandons d’installer ce produit sur Visual Studio Professional ou Enterprise, qui prend en charge l’activation hors connexion via une clé de produit.